Knowing The Perfect Golf Swing Technique

Posted on October 7th, 2010 by admin in Sports & Recreation | No Comments »

Most golfers think that the simplest and perhaps the most commonly taught golf swing technique is one in which you, the golfer have to learn to take up the club up along a target line and then start the downswing. However, with a little more research, you will soon discover that this is perhaps not the best technique after all.

This is because such a golf swing technique can result in unwanted shift in the weight which is not what a good golfer should be aiming for. Instead, they need to learn to coil their upper bodies over their right hips. If you try and move the weight laterally, this can cause the golfer to lose their balance.

In addition, this kind of technique can also result in a disconnection between the arms and the body. So, it is better to avoid the technique involving lifting the club in the direction of the target line.

This is because the arms will be swinging the club without being properly connected to the body. The right technique is to ensure working arms and body together in perfect coordination. This will ensure a much more powerful swing and that means obtaining greater distance.

By making use of a flawed golf swing technique you will risk closing the face of your golf club unnecessarily which then leads to making inaccurate drives. A proper technique is one in which the swing is worked in an arc in which the center corresponds to the chest region. In addition, you must also hold the golf club with both hands in a closed grip.

You should aim to create a backswing in which the club always remains on the plane for as long as is possible. The longer time the club remains on the plane the easier it becomes to strike the ball with consistently high accuracy and power.

Kettlebell Training

Posted on September 28th, 2010 by admin in Sports & Recreation | No Comments »

Kettlebells are increasing in popularity to a tremendous level. The reason for this is that kettlebells engage all the muscles in the body and enhance strength and muscular development to a great degree. Best of all, such enhancements will particularly enhance athletic skills to a great degree. Why is this? Kettlebells are not lifted. Rather, kettlebells are swung which employs motion and control into the training exercises. This duplicates the way the body performs when involved in athletics. This is why kettlebells make such an excellent training tool when looking to boost your ability to perform as a competitive athlete.

Plyometrics exercises will help you with jumping!

Posted on September 28th, 2010 by admin in Sports & Recreation | No Comments »

Plyometric exercises are those that are fast and quick. They work by lengthening and then rapidly contracting the muscle groups associated with any particular set of exercises. For instance, you can do various types of plyometric exercises for the upper and lower body as well as for core training. Some to the various exercises include clap push-ups, jump squats, hopping and skipping as well as bounding, lunging, sprinting and hopping. All of these exercises involve making quick and fast movements. You can achieve a stress-free game environment, by conditioning and training the various muscle groups while doing plyometric exercises today.

About Rock Climbing

Posted on September 26th, 2010 by admin in Sports & Recreation | No Comments »

The beginning of rock climbing started with mountaineers that used rock climbing to train mountaineers. When mountaineers were getting ready to go on an expedition where the terrain that may be steep or rocky, they practiced to negotiate that terrain by rock climbing. In the 1920s took climbing was a tool to help improve ones climbing skills, but it was not until the 1950s that rock climbing became a sport in America.

The history of rock climbing tells us that a grading system had to be put in place as more people became interested in the sport of rock climbing. This grading system determines the difficulty of the climb and the climbers ability to accomplish it.

There is both indoor and outdoor rock climbing, although in the indoor version there not a large rock to climb but a wall. This is a great alternative for someone that wants to experience or train for rock climbing.
